We are celebrating our 17th Birthday at Allsorts this week, so there is a special challenge with fabulous prizes. The theme this time is 'Anything Goes'. My DT card is a masculine Centre Pop-Out Card.
The patterned papers are from the Sara Davies Nautical Collection paper pad, with plain navy blue mats. The sentiment was made with Sue Wilson 'Happy Birthday' dies.
